How to handle adding cable trays

How to handle adding cable trays

Adding cable trays requires careful planning, proper support, correct tray selection, and adherence to NEC standards to ensure safety and functionality.Planning the RouteBefore installing a cable tray, plan the route carefully. Mark the path on walls or ceilings using a chalk line or laser level, ensuring it avoids obstructions like pipes, HVAC ducts, or other equipment. Identify points for bends, tees, or elevation changes (risers) and ensure adequate clearance for maintenance, typically at least 12 inches above the tray .Selecting the Right TrayChoose the appropriate tray type based on cable type, load, and environment:Ladder trays: Ideal for heavy power cables, allow airflow, and easy cable entry .Perforated trays: Support lighter loads and provide ventilation.Solid-bottom trays: Offer EMI protection for sensitive circuits but may reduce heat dissipation.Wire mesh or channel trays: Suitable for light instrumentation or aesthetic applications .Sizing and Load ConsiderationsCalculate tray width and depth based on the number and type of cables. Do not exceed fill limits: 40% for power cables and 50% for control cables. Ensure supports are spaced according to manufacturer specifications, typically 1.5 to 3 meters apart, to prevent sagging .Installation StepsInstall Supports: Use wall arms, ceiling struts, or threaded rods with anchor bolts. Ensure supports are level and aligned.Assemble Trays: Connect sections using couplers or splice plates. Deburr edges to prevent cable damage.Lay Cables: Organize cables by voltage and function using cable ties or straps. Leave slack for expansion or future adjustments.Grounding and Bonding: Metallic trays must be properly grounded to serve as equipment grounding conductors if required by NEC .Material SelectionSelect tray material based on environmental conditions:Aluminum: Lightweight, corrosion-resistant.Steel: Durable for heavy-duty use.FRP (Fiber-Reinforced Plastic): Ideal for corrosive environments .Compliance and SafetyFollow NEC Article 392 and local regulations. Avoid installing trays in hoistways or enclosed spaces, maintain proper separation between high-power and low-power cables to prevent EMI, and ensure trays remain accessible for maintenance . By following these steps, you can safely add cable trays, maintain organized wiring, and ensure compliance with electrical codes while supporting future expansion.
